- Lead recruitment and yield efforts for international students.
- Represent the university at international student recruitment conferences, conventions, fairs, and other appropriate meetings or events.
- Create and oversee new strategies for international lead generation and yield.
- Coordinate with marketing team to update international website pages and digital content.
- Collaborate with international agents and OPM partners to grow enrollment.
- Develop and manage on-ground recruitment efforts in viable international markets to build presence, market saturation, and feeder program pathways.
- Lead a high performing, results-focused international admissions team.
- Establish and implement fast, efficient, and competitive international admissions and I-20 processes and policies.
- Ensure all international admissions policies are consistent with WASC, Department of Homeland Security/SEVIS, and State Department regulations and requirements.
- Coordinate and support Global Education and International Student Services teams, including all international orientation events on campus to ensure student success.
- Serve as Designated School Official (DSO) and Alternate Responsible Officer (ARO).
- Perform analytics on international recruitment efforts to ensure the greatest return on investment and enrollment growth, while maintaining student quality
- Coordinate with Division of Student Success to ensure availability of options for international student housing.
- Develop training guidelines for both international recruitment and admissions.
- Proactively identify trends and concerns of prospective student populations and implement strategies to leverage those trends to achieve student enrollment growth.
- Communicate and consult with other university departments to improve international admissions and recruitment processes.
- Provide enrollment reports and analysis to various constituencies as requested.
- Fulfill other duties as assigned by the Vice Provost of Global Affairs, Provost, or President.

BASIC FUNCTION AND SCOPE OF JOB:
Under the supervision of the Vice Provost for Global Affairs, the Director of International Recruitment and Admissions will oversee a high performing international recruitment and admissions team; partner with international recruiters, OPMs, and universities; and collaborate with various administrative and academic units to grow international enrollment at GGU on campus, online, and at international locations.
